Visual Foxpro Runtime version 20, para pruebas, de Visual Foxpro Advanced 64 bits y 32 bits, Visual Foxpro 9 7423, Visual Foxpro 8 sp1 y los Encryptadores

1,494 views
Skip to first unread message

Germán Fabricio Valdez

unread,
Jan 19, 2017, 3:31:47 PM1/19/17
to Comunidad de Visual Foxpro en Español
instalando estos ejecutables tendran todo lo necesario para que convivan todos los Visual Foxpro en una misma PC

32 bits

64 bits y 32 bits

Carton Jeston (9.0.0.7423)

unread,
Jan 19, 2017, 3:47:25 PM1/19/17
to Comunidad de Visual Foxpro en Español
¿Podias explicar en que consiste la instalacion? Tengo el vfp9 conviviendo con el vfpa sin problema y me da cosa no saber que hara... bueno, si lo hago en la particion de windows 10 no perderia  nada pero...   :)

¿Son solo los runtime para una instalacion limpia o algo mas?

Carton Jeston (9.0.0.7423)

unread,
Jan 19, 2017, 3:47:57 PM1/19/17
to Comunidad de Visual Foxpro en Español
Ah, y  gracias por el esfuerzo ;)

German Fabricio Valdez

unread,
Jan 19, 2017, 3:53:20 PM1/19/17
to publice...@googlegroups.com

para una instalacion limpia o una actualizacion

para poder empezar a hacer pruebas

Rodribezul

unread,
Jan 19, 2017, 6:49:58 PM1/19/17
to Comunidad de Visual Foxpro en Español

Cual es la utilidad practica en esta version para el mundo web y/o donde estaría la ganancia en el mundo cliente servidor?..  Por que hay que comprar unos compiladores ?


Saludos

Rodrigo

German Fabricio Valdez

unread,
Jan 19, 2017, 7:03:11 PM1/19/17
to publice...@googlegroups.com

la idea es probar la version 10 que sea totalmente compatible con la 9

cuando microsoft libere el Visual Foxpro 9 se vendran nuevas versiones de Visual Foxpro

no se si microsoft lo vendera al codigo o sera libre

en principio la version de 64 bits ya no tiene el limite de 2gb por tabla

en esta ultima version es compatible con campos memos y blob de servidores remotos via ODBC

el mundo web usa otras herramientas

nosotros usamos clientes servidor y terminal server


con respecto a los compiladores VC++ es para crear ejecutables hechos en Visual Foxpro como si estuvieran

hecho en Visual Studio

si alguna empresa no quiere fox tendras esa alternativa sin saber nada de codigo de VC++

Germán Fabricio Valdez

unread,
Jan 21, 2017, 8:23:13 PM1/21/17
to Comunidad de Visual Foxpro en Español
instalando estos ejecutables en las pc del cliente funcionaran los exes generados en los Visual Foxpro 9 7423, Visual Foxpro Advanced 10 32 bits, Visual Foxpro Advanced 10 64 bits y Visual foxpro 8 sp1 y si Encrypatron los EXES tambien funcionaran

Cuando generan el ejecutable de un proyecto se usan los archivos runtime del Visual Foxpro que usarion, no porque esten todos se usa el ultimo

esto les permitira probar las versiones nuevas de sus ejecutables en Visual Foxpro Advaced 10 y si existe algun problema pueden recompilar el exe en Visual Foxpro 9 y solo reemplazar el ejecutable y usara los runtime de la 7423 o la de ADvanced de 32 bits

y tratar de identificar que instruccion causa el problema para informarle a chen

recuerden que los OCX usados en versiones de Visual Foxpro 9 funcionan en Visual Foxpro Advanced de 32 bits pero no en la de 64 bits

Marcelo Barberis

unread,
Jan 21, 2017, 8:35:39 PM1/21/17
to publicesvfoxpro

Consulto usando los encriptadores q se menciona tipo refox se puede pasar a un exe hecho en vfp9sp1?

Alguien hizo pruebas di con refox se puede ver un exe pasado con estos encriptadores

German Fabricio Valdez

unread,
Jan 21, 2017, 8:44:32 PM1/21/17
to publice...@googlegroups.com
con  solo compilarlo en Visual Foxpro Advanced 32 o 64 bits ya REFOX no lo reconoce

y si encima si lo encryptas y comprimis menos

Desconozco si funciona el encripador con versiones de Visual Foxpro que no sea la advanced 10, no he hecho pruebas

Marcelo Barberis

unread,
Jan 21, 2017, 8:59:24 PM1/21/17
to publicesvfoxpro

Yo consultaba por se ofrece en $us 400

German Fabricio Valdez

unread,
Jan 21, 2017, 9:24:00 PM1/21/17
to publice...@googlegroups.com

los que se ofrecen por 400 dolares son compiladores de Visual Studio VC++

una vez generado en VC++ se necesita un descompilador de VC++, ya nada tiene que ver con Visual Foxpro

Esto es util para generar ejecutables que nada tengan que ver con Visual Foxpro en Visual Studio sin saber nada de  VC++ y seguir programando en Visual Foxpro

Carton Jeston (9.0.0.7423)

unread,
Jan 22, 2017, 7:15:57 AM1/22/17
to Comunidad de Visual Foxpro en Español

Ademas el compilador amplia limites del fox original, parchea errores, etc. Regularmente ves que lo adapta para que sea compatible con versiones superiores de VS y eso implica que mientras dure esa version de VS (actualmente Visual C++ 14.0 (Visual Studio 2015), el fox continuara (hasta ahora uso la VS2010 por mantener la compatibilidad con XP).

Yo recomiendo empezar con la version demo y una copia de vuestra aplicacion para empezar a familiarizarse. Hay que hacer cambios en el codigo y ver que dependencias a libreria de terceros se usan, especialmente cuando quieras dar el salto a los 64bits. Por ejemplo, no se soporta STORE 1 TO x asi que lo cambias por x=1 y algunas pecularidades minimas. Otro ejemplo es si usas una FLL de comunicaciones solo para enviar un email, la sustituyes por una rutina que haga exactamente lo que necesitas o bien una libreria con su codigo fuente.

Ahora no lo se, pero estuve unos meses probando con la version demo en produccion y no hubo problema. Eso si, el exe tiene menos proteccion y menos optimizacion y se notaba ligeramente en la velocidad pero me sirvio para decidirme y dar el salto. No es facil ni barato pero al final cuando consegui unas ventas con el exe "demo" (si, era arriesgado) entonces inverti parte del beneficio en el compilador full.

Ojo, no trato de convencer a nadie, ni que el futuro siga solo en foxpro, pero como vivi aquella experiencia de que foxpro 2.6 dejo de funcionar de un dia para otro segun que cpu tenia el cliente, intento no quedarme con el trasero al aire otra vez :)

Lo que recomiendo es que jueguen con el VFPA y el VFP COMPILER DEMO y contribuyan a detectar cualquier error o adaptar librerias y compartir la experiencia por aqui, todo menos sentarnos a esperar el dia en que el zorro estire la pata.

Ya he pasado como mucho de vosotros por el frenesi de probar diferentes "sustitutos" del fox y al dia de hoy (veremos que pasa con alaska) no he encontrado. Eso no quita seguir las recomendaciones de otros compañeros que ya han migrado a otras plataformas, pero este camino es el menos traumatico.

mapner

unread,
Jan 22, 2017, 8:38:31 AM1/22/17
to Comunidad de Visual Foxpro en Español
Carton Jeston,

A que te refieres con que el EXE tiene menos protección y menos optimización?
Al compilarlo en C++ no debería optimizar velocidad y rendimiento?

Saludos

German Fabricio Valdez

unread,
Jan 22, 2017, 1:43:27 PM1/22/17
to publice...@googlegroups.com
en la ultima version de Visual Foxpro Advanced 64

si funciona Store 1 to x


El 22/1/2017 a las 09:15, Carton Jeston (9.0.0.7423) escribió:
> STORE 1 TO x

Carton Jeston (9.0.0.7423)

unread,
Jan 23, 2017, 2:29:21 AM1/23/17
to Comunidad de Visual Foxpro en Español
En la version demo del compilador no dejaba activar ciertas funciones como optimizaciones extra y ciertas protecciones y funcionalidades, por lo menos hace un par de años asi era, y no parecia tener problema en ejecutar el exe en pc de clientes. Eso es algo que no estaria mal comprobar si ha cambiado, porque como dije, me permitio probarlo en produccion y de paso hacer unas ventas e invertir en el compilador full.

Carton Jeston (9.0.0.7423)

unread,
Jan 23, 2017, 2:32:12 AM1/23/17
to Comunidad de Visual Foxpro en Español

En el ultimo mensaje estaba hablando del compilador, el VFPA mantiene la compatibilidad con VFP9, pero para compilar necesitas hacer algunos cambios minimos en el codigo, revisar algunas librerias, etc.

ZeRoberto

unread,
Jan 23, 2017, 4:09:57 PM1/23/17
to publicesvfoxpro
El VFP Advanced tiene un pequeo detalle, cuando creo un exe el icono de la aplicacion no se muestra en la barra de windows, adjunto imagen



German Fabricio Valdez

unread,
Jan 23, 2017, 4:28:58 PM1/23/17
to publice...@googlegroups.com

estas agregando el icono en menu project , info


en visual foxpro advaced de 32 bits lo pone


En visual foxpro advanced 64 si lo pone

ZeRoberto

unread,
Jan 23, 2017, 8:55:26 PM1/23/17
to publicesvfoxpro
Bueno ahora ni el mismo VFP me visualiza el icono, parece que la instalacion del VFPA me a alterado algo en la pc.




larue...@yahoo.com

unread,
Jan 23, 2017, 9:26:16 PM1/23/17
to publice...@googlegroups.com

--------------------------------------------
On Tue, 1/24/17, ZeRoberto <zero...@gmail.com> wrote:

Subject: Re: [vfp] Re: Visual Foxpro Runtime version 20, para pruebas, de Visual Foxpro Advanced 64 bits y 32 bits, Visual Foxpro 9 7423, Visual Foxpro 8 sp1 y los Encryptadores
To: "publicesvfoxpro" <publice...@googlegroups.com>
Date: Tuesday, January 24, 2017, 3:55 AM

Bueno
ahora ni el mismo VFP me visualiza el icono, parece que la
instalacion del VFPA me a alterado algo en la pc.




ntre timp in tara se inregistreaza primul semn de sange al veacului. tarani rasculati la 1907 sunt ucisi sau raniti de armata din ordinul autoritatilor presate si de un factor extrem de periculos armatele Austro-Ungariei ocupa pozitii de atac pe linia Carpatilor iar cele ale Rusiei la Prut . Dumnezeu sa-i ierte scrie N. lorga in ziarul Neamul Romanesc indemnand la o reconciliere din care rezulta prezenta eroica a fiilor satelor in Razboiul pentru Reintregirea Nationala 1916-1919 . Mobilizati de un guvern condus de Ion I.C. Bratianu si comandati intre alti generali de Alexandru Averescu peste 800 000 de ostasi participa la cele trei campanii de pe frontul romanesc 300 000 dintre ei jertfindu-si viata pentru supremul ideal national.

ZeRoberto

unread,
Jan 23, 2017, 10:08:21 PM1/23/17
to publicesvfoxpro

Bueno pasando a otro tema por que me sale deshabilitado la opcion de instalar Visual C++, cuando quiero instalar VFP C++ Compiler ?



Douglas Sánchez

unread,
Jan 24, 2017, 5:33:05 PM1/24/17
to publice...@googlegroups.com
Instala visual c++ descargalo de Microsoft

Slds

ZeRoberto

unread,
Jan 24, 2017, 9:36:42 PM1/24/17
to publicesvfoxpro
Hay que instalar todo el visual studio?

Douglas Sánchez

unread,
Jan 25, 2017, 1:13:37 PM1/25/17
to publice...@googlegroups.com
no solo visual c++

El 24 de enero de 2017, 20:36, ZeRoberto <zero...@gmail.com> escribió:
Hay que instalar todo el visual studio?

ZeRoberto

unread,
Jan 25, 2017, 3:23:21 PM1/25/17
to publicesvfoxpro
Te refieres a los RunTimes eso hice pero nada?

Germán Fabricio Valdez

unread,
Jan 25, 2017, 3:36:56 PM1/25/17
to Comunidad de Visual Foxpro en Español
hay que instalar el Visual Studio, el 2015 es el ultimo y no compila para XP ni para vista

lo que si tenes que tener es una buena maquina sino te la ralentiza un monton, de toda la basura que instala

si queres para XP o vista usa el Visual Studio 2010


El jueves, 19 de enero de 2017, 17:31:47 (UTC-3), Germán Fabricio Valdez escribió:

ZeRoberto

unread,
Jan 25, 2017, 3:45:09 PM1/25/17
to publicesvfoxpro
Gracias German voy revisarlo.

Saludos

Carton Jeston (9.0.0.7423)

unread,
Jan 28, 2017, 4:43:50 AM1/28/17
to Comunidad de Visual Foxpro en Español
Los runtimes no tienen el compilador de c++. Te recomiendo el VS2010 EXPRESS para compatibilidad con XP sp3 en adelante.

Echa un ojo a estos links, que en su dia me sirvieron de guia:

http://www.marathongriffincomputers.com/Computers/VFPCPlusCompiler.html
http://www.baiyujia.com/vfpdocuments/f_vcreadme_en.asp

Germán Fabricio Valdez

unread,
Jan 31, 2017, 4:28:37 AM1/31/17
to Comunidad de Visual Foxpro en Español
hay una version 24 para descargar actualizada para el visual foxpro advanced 64 bits de 2007.01.31 que soporta ADO y cursoradapter mediante ADO

https://groups.google.com/forum/#!topic/publicesvfoxpro/LsuY2wNehuU

Gerardo Baron

unread,
Feb 4, 2017, 9:58:28 AM2/4/17
to Comunidad de Visual Foxpro en Español
Los links para bajar el VFPA están deshabilitados, nos puedes enviar otros.  Una pregunta ¿cuando bajas el VFP Advanced 10 64 bits, este es un IDE de VFP el cual compila o hay que bajar un compilador aparte?.  Otra pregunta ¿Necesitas Solo el VFP 9 y VFP ADVANCE 64 o 32 bits para programar o compilar o tambien necesitas el visual studio, o otro programa?

Gracias 

German Fabricio Valdez

unread,
Feb 4, 2017, 10:35:48 AM2/4/17
to publice...@googlegroups.com

hola hay una version mas nuevas de todo lo que publique

el vfpa 64 bits tiene su propio ide igual al del visual foxpro 9 y no necesitas visual studio

esta publicada en el foro de google

igual aca te dejo el link

https://groups.google.com/forum/#!topic/publicesvfoxpro/LsuY2wNehuU

saludos

Gerardo Baron

unread,
Feb 4, 2017, 3:09:11 PM2/4/17
to Comunidad de Visual Foxpro en Español
Gracias ya la baje.  Acabo de instalar la version 32 bits, pero no encuentro diferencia con el antiguo VFP9, asumo que el cambio esta solo en la version 64 ¿Correcto?  

Gracias

German Fabricio Valdez

unread,
Feb 4, 2017, 4:03:08 PM2/4/17
to publice...@googlegroups.com

es otra compilacion con vc++ 10 no tiene grandes diferencia de compatibilidad con visual foxpro 9

el refox no lo reconoce para descompilarlo

visual foxpro 10 advanced 64 bits esta compilado con vc++ 10 64 bits pero hay que hacer varios ajustes

que ya hace años se vienen haciendo 

la version actual esta bastante estable por lo que he probado

igual cualquier error que encuentren se lo comunican el email de chen o al mio

Gerardo Baron

unread,
Feb 4, 2017, 11:26:14 PM2/4/17
to Comunidad de Visual Foxpro en Español
Gracias German ya instale la de 64 bits y he compilado un par de programas en 64 bits y todo bien.

Gran aporte

Saludos

Reply all
Reply to author
Forward
0 new messages